I think most of the changes have been happening in the undergrad programs, but yes WGU does adapt their degree programs and course selections to reflect new material at least every few years. More often for courses that evolve quickly or for those that are troublesome for one reason or another.
In any case, this is another reason to use the program guide as your reference, since those get updated first.
